Output 8553f688047a3592e2764655c4a120c03bf449ddca2e3ce5da31e7fbafe122b0:0

value
250804940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62f9d3b1cbc2f8b704b4a72aa2392dec1e7be835 OP_EQUAL
address
3AiMRd4tD91wH8Ys9pbMkzhc4FH9RX1Wz9
transaction
8553f688047a3592e2764655c4a120c03bf449ddca2e3ce5da31e7fbafe122b0
confirmations
452812
spent
true